Christmas Market at El Corte Inglés Tenerife: Lights, Shopping and Festive Atmosphere
Every December, the esplanade in front of El Corte Inglés in Tenerife turns into a vibrant Christmas market where locals and visitors come to soak up the festive atmosphere. Between the towering illuminated tree, rows of decorated wooden stalls and comfortable seating areas, this open-air space becomes one of the most popular spots in Santa Cruz de Tenerife for holiday shopping and family walks.
The market combines the convenience of a major department store with the charm of a traditional Christmas fair, offering everything from toys and decorations to sweets and hot snacks. The first impression is dominated by the giant metallic Christmas tree right in front of the main façade of El Corte Inglés. Visitors arrive from the surrounding streets and are welcomed by the illuminated structure and a bright red carpet that marks the entrance to the festive area.
Just a few steps away from the main entrance, the market opens out into a central square lined with small wooden huts. Each stall is decorated with garlands, lights and Christmas ornaments, creating a cosy village atmosphere in the heart of the city. The red carpet continues across the entire area, inviting visitors to stroll, shop and take photos.
Many of these huts are dedicated to traditional Christmas gifts: sweets, nougat, decorations and small souvenirs that are ideal for stocking fillers or Secret Santa presents. The decorations and lighting make the whole area feel like a small northern European market, even though the mild climate of Tenerife allows visitors to enjoy it in light clothing and without winter snow.
Families with children will find several stalls focused on toys, plush figures and festive clothing. Signs like “Ho Ho Ho” and well-known brands create an attractive area for younger visitors, who can choose gifts while parents enjoy a relaxed shopping experience without leaving the outdoor market.
A classic element of Spanish Christmas is the Belén, or nativity scene, and the El Corte Inglés market includes its own detailed miniature village. Carefully arranged figures, buildings and landscapes recreate biblical scenes and traditional architecture, inviting visitors to stop and admire the craftsmanship through the glass display.
This nativity display is a popular photo spot and an opportunity to appreciate one of the most deeply rooted Christmas traditions in Spain. It adds a cultural and devotional touch to a market otherwise filled with shopping, snacks and leisure.
No Christmas market is complete without good food, and the outdoor area at El Corte Inglés Tenerife includes food trucks and casual eateries where you can refuel. Visitors can order burgers, snacks and drinks and then sit at the white picnic tables under bright orange parasols.
This open-air terrace is ideal for taking a break between shops, meeting friends or simply enjoying the mild winter weather of the Canary Islands. As evening falls, the hanging string lights switch on above the tables, adding a warm atmosphere that invites people to stay longer.
